About

Pascal Janne is a scholar working on Clinical Psychology, General Health Professions and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Pascal Janne has authored 65 papers receiving a total of 611 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 20 papers in Clinical Psychology, 15 papers in General Health Professions and 11 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Pascal Janne’s work include Psychoanalysis and Psychopathology Research (10 papers), Family Support in Illness (7 papers) and Patient-Provider Communication in Healthcare (4 papers). Pascal Janne is often cited by papers focused on Psychoanalysis and Psychopathology Research (10 papers), Family Support in Illness (7 papers) and Patient-Provider Communication in Healthcare (4 papers). Pascal Janne collaborates with scholars based in Belgium, Ireland and Iran. Pascal Janne's co-authors include Christine Reynaert, Yves Libert, Darius Razavi, Sandrine Conradt, Jacques Boniver, Nicolas Zdanowicz, Isabelle Merckaert, Jean Klášterský, Pierre Scalliet and Ovide Fontaine and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, Cancer and European Heart Journal.
